Technics SL-1200MK7
Image source — © Technics

Technics SL-1200MK7 is a direct–drive vinyl record player. Direct-drive turntables use a slow-rotation motor that drives a support disc. Such a system has many advantages: for example, high rotational accuracy and torque, which ensures the durability and reliability of the components.

Specifications

  • Model name

    SL-1200MK7

  • Speed

    33/45/78

  • Drive

    Direct-drive

  • Suspension

    Fixed

  • Tonearm preinstalled

    N/A

  • Tonearm model

    N/A

  • Cartridge preinstalled

    N/A

  • Cartridge model

    N/A

  • Platter

    Aluminium

  • Motor

    AC

  • Wow and Flutter (%)

    N/A

  • Signal to Noise (dB)

    N/A

  • Rumble (-dB)

    N/A

  • Dimensions (mm)

    453 x 169 x 353

  • Weight (kg)

    21.2

    Technics SL-1000RE-S

    The player has an updated motor that rotates the support disc according to the direct drive principle. The engine has a dual electromagnetic system, due to which it was possible to radically increase the smoothness of the ride and almost completely eliminate any vibrations.

    Technics SP-10RE-S

    The Technics SP-10RE-S reference-grade vinyl turntable system features a direct drive motor without a core and a heavy plate for stable rotation. It is equipped with a separate control unit to suppress the impact of unwanted noise on the main unit. These meticulous noise reduction measures ensure the highest S/N levels in the world.

    Technics SL-1210G-K

    The motor is equipped with a double rotor, which significantly reduces the load on the bearings, reduces vibrations and provides high torque. The electric motor is controlled using a high-precision system that was developed for Blu-ray players, which promotes rapid disc rotation and increases the stability of its rotation. Speeds of 33.3, 45 or 78 rpm are supported, which can be selected using the buttons.

    Technics SL-1200G-S

    The player received a reference disc with notches that allow using a strobe light to adjust each of the three supported rotation speeds (33.3, 45 and 78 rpm) as precisely as possible, which are selected by a pair of buttons located on the upper panel of the case.

    Technics SL-1210GR2

    In the GR2 model, the motor control signal is generated using a PWM signal generated by ΔΣ (delta sigma) modulation, a high-precision 1-bit digital-to-analog conversion method that is part of signal processing in Technics fully digital amplifiers using the patented JENO Engine technology.
